The successful NRU series for edge AI applications from German distributor Acceed has received a special addition. The already fanless chassis design for operation at high temperatures has been further optimised thanks to an unusual redesign. The now full-surface, flat heat sink maximises cooling efficiency across the entire top of the housing, allowing the controller to be used in closed housings or confined spaces with reduced airflow. The robust NRU-154PoE-FT has four GbE interfaces (2.5 Gb) with PoE and is designed for operation in ambient temperatures from -25 to +60 °C.

PCIe-DAQ cards (Peripheral Component Interconnect Express - Data Acquisition Cards) are a key technology in measurement applications and form the high-performance interface for digital signal processing and data acquisition. The new PCIe-9100 series multiplexer DAQ cards from Adlink, which are now available from German distributor Acceed, have been developed for use in demanding industrial measurement and control systems. They combine high input resolution for precise data acquisition with a choice of different channel counts and configurations, making them a preferred choice for demanding applications, for example in data analysis, development, performance control or automation.

Box PCs and embedded controllers often have to be installed in very small spaces or in tight control cabinets. The limited space is a challenge for heat dissipation. Inadequate temperature management can quickly lead to problems with performance and operational reliability. The new POC-700-FT controller, now available from German distributor Acceed, offers an efficient solution. The innovative design with the newly developed full-surface, flat heat sink maximises cooling efficiency via the housing surface and allows safe fanless operation in industrial environments.

Computers for the intelligent control of unmanned vehicles and stationary robots, also in industrial surroundings for a longer period with AI-based applications. However, manufacturers and constructors are faced with a special type of challenge when handling flying devices, e.g. drones which are applied in an industrial context. The weight of all components then plays a supporting role in the literal sense. Specifically tailored to such applications, the German distributor Acceed has now added the ultralight box computer FLYC-300 from the experienced manufacturer Neousys to its programme. With its flyweight of a mere 297 grams and an AI processor power of 100 TOPS, the controller is suitable for various applications in unmanned systems, in particular airborne vehicles, but also agricultural machinery and autonomous mobile robots of a smaller size, to name just a few further examples.

As their name already indicates, access points basically only have one simple task: the extension of the network via radio technology in an efficient manner with access points. However, within industrial surroundings, higher requirements must be met, including temperature tolerance, robustness and safety. Last but not least, the speed plays an important role for successful data communication in virtually all business fields. The German distributor Acceed has now incorporated the new high-speed access point IAP-1800AX from Planet into its programme, which with Wi-Fi 6, two radio frequencies (dual band 2.4 GHz, 5 GHz), a wide temperature range from -40 to +75 °C and five LAN interfaces in a stable metal casing is designated for professional use.
